TATA INSTITUTE OF FUNDAMENTAL RESEARCH
National Centre of the Government of India for Nuclear Science & Mathematics
Homi Bhabha Road, Colaba, Mumbai 400 005
Advertisement No. 5/2011
Applications are invited for the following post tenable at Mumbai :
SCIENTIFIC OFFICER (C) : One Post [Unreserved] ; Pay Band (PB-3) : Rs.15600-39100 + Grade Pay : Rs.5400/- ; TME: Rs.42,842/- ; HQ : Mumbai.
Qual : B.E./B.Tech. in Electrical/Electronics/Computer Science/Telecommunications with 60% marks.
ORM.Sc. in Computer Science/IT with minimum 60% marks.
Experience : 1 - 2 years of experience in System/Network administration.
Desirable : i) Formal certification in networking and security. (ii) Experience in installation of Linux preferably on servers. (iii) Knowledge of HTML, bash scripting PHP. (iv) Experience in system/network administration. (v) Experience in setting up and trouble shooting wireless networks, VLAN etc. (vi) Should be open to and capable of acquiring new skills as required. (vii) Good communication and interpersonal skills.
Job Requirement : i) Selection of hardware/software, installation and maintenance (Linux & Windows). (ii) User help. (iii) Administration of department LAN and wireless network. (iv) Maintenance of department web servers, internet services and web pages.
Age : Below 28 years.

Advertisement No. 10/2011
Applications are invited for the following posts tenable at Mumbai.
PROJECT ASSISTANT : Two posts (1 – Unreserved and 1 - reserved for Scheduled Caste) [Both the posts are temporary till March 2012). Monthly honorarium : Rs.17,000/-.
Qualification : B.E./B.Tech./M.E./M.Tech. in Electronics/Telecommunications/Computer Science/ Information Technology with atleast 60% marks in aggregate OR high second class (atleast 55% marks in aggregate) with experience in speech signal processing.
Desirable Qualifications : (a) Work experience in digital signal processing or pattern recognition; (b) Hands on experience in Linux.
Nature of work : To work on a speech recognition project that implements a voice interface for information retrieval using advanced speech recognition technologies. Candidates will have to do application-specific research and development work that includes understanding research papers, implementing algorithms in C, modify existing C/C++ code and writing shell/perl/php scripts in linux environment.
Age : Below 28 years for unreserved candidates and below 33 years for scheduled caste candidates.
Prescribed age should not exceed as on January 1, 2011.
Applications, in plain paper, giving full details together with copies of relevant certificates/testimonials in the following format and superscribing the post applied for on the envelope should reach Establishment Officer on or before May 20, 2011. Candidates shortlisted for interview will be intimated primarily by email. Interviews are likely to be held in the first week of June 2011.
Advertisement No. 8/2011
Applications are invited for the following post tenable at Mumbai :
Advertisement for Junior Research Fellow to work on the project involves profiling of gene expression, including microRNAs from tissues and cells grown in culture.
One post temporary for one year on a DBT grant.
Qualification : Master's degree in life sciences from a reputed university.
Desirable : A prior exposure/training in RNA quantification, microarray analysis and cell culture is ideal but not mandatory.
Interested candidates are requested to apply alongwith a statement of purpose along with their CV and two reference letters by post to the Establishment Officer, TIFR on or before 13th May, 2011.
